技术文摘
11 个微前端的误解解析
2024-12-31 06:06:31 小编
11 个微前端的误解解析
在当今的前端开发领域,微前端的概念日益流行,但同时也伴随着许多误解。以下将为您解析 11 个常见的微前端误解。
误解一:微前端只是用于大型项目。实际上,无论项目规模大小,微前端都能带来更好的模块划分和代码维护性。
误解二:微前端会大幅增加复杂性。合理的架构设计和工具选择能有效控制复杂度,反而提升开发效率。
误解三:所有前端框架都适合微前端。不同框架的特性不同,需要根据项目需求和团队技术栈来选择。
误解四:微前端意味着完全独立的开发流程。虽然模块相对独立,但仍需要一定的协调和统一规范。
误解五:微前端无需考虑性能优化。多个微前端模块的组合可能带来性能挑战,需要针对性优化。
误解六:微前端可以随意拆分应用。过度拆分可能导致模块之间的通信和协作困难。
误解七:微前端技术成熟度低。经过不断发展,已有成熟的解决方案和实践案例。
误解八:微前端只关注前端代码。实际上,还需要考虑后端服务的集成和数据共享。
误解九:微前端不需要测试策略。每个微前端模块都需要充分的测试来保证质量。
误解十:微前端能立即解决所有问题。它是一种解决方案,但并非万能药,需要结合实际情况运用。
误解十一:微前端的学习成本很高。掌握核心概念和常用工具,逐步实践,学习成本并非不可承受。
正确理解微前端的概念和应用场景,避免这些误解,才能充分发挥微前端的优势,为前端开发带来更高的效率和更好的可维护性。
- 秒拍播放链路优化实践:每日数亿视频播放量
- 你对 JavaScript 的函数式编程了解多少?
- JavaScript 内存泄露的处理之道
- 左右脑年龄测试风靡朋友圈 程序员出面辟谣
- Go 语言编写工具的终极指引
- 充分利用 Python 与 Sqlite3
- 2017 年中国程序员调查:大数据就业前景宽广
- 以下几个小例子揭示一行 Python 代码的威力
- 腾讯熊普江:二十年老司机谈微服务架构的优势与痛点
- Python Selenium 助力歌曲免费下载爬虫实践
- 五天面试 5 家科技巨头且全获 Offer,他的经验分享
- Tomcat 安全域的实现细节剖析
- Tomcat 中可插拔与 SCI 的实现原理
- Tomcat 状态是 UP 还是 DOWN 的检测方法
- Python 面试必考的 8 个问题,你知晓吗?